About Amanda Lee

Amanda Lee is Emeritus Professor in the School of Public Health at The University of Queensland. She has over 40 years experience as a “pracademic” in public health nutrition and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ander health in academia, government and non-government sectors. Her major research interests involve generating and synthesizing public health nutrition evidence and translating evidence into nutrition and healthy weight policy and practice. Amanda chaired the Australian National Health and Medical Research Council’s (NHMRC) Dietary Guidelines Working Committee that produced food-based dietary guidelines underpinned by strong scientific evidence. She is currently Chair of Food Standard's Australia and New Zealand's Consumer and Public Health Dialogue and a member of the Australian Academy of Sciences Nutrition Committee. She serves on many other national and international nutrition, obesity and chronic disease prevention advisory and working groups, including the food price and affordability domain of the International Network for Food and Obesity/Non-communicable Diseases Research, Monitoring and Action Support (INFORMAS), a global network that aims to monitor, evaluate and support public and private sector actions to improve food environments and reduce obesity and chronic disease. Amongst key activities Amanda has scoped the new national food and nutrition policy, helped finalize the national Healthy Weight Guide in Australia, worked with state/territory jurisdictions to prioritise policy actions to prevent obesity and address barriers to the uptake of dietary guidelines and developed the Healthy Diets ASAP (Australian Standardised Affordability and Pricing) method to assess the price and affordability of healthy and current diets. She is nutrition consultant for the NPY Women’s Council and Adjunct Professor at Several Universities.
